Latest Patents
Tammaru's latest patents include a data scrambler and a one-bit-out-of-N-bit checking circuit. The data scrambler patent describes a method for randomizing binary digital data signal patterns. This is achieved by constructing a key signal from a summation of selected stored digits of the data pattern. The resulting scrambled line signal is free of concentrated signal energy at particular frequencies, ensuring reliable recovery of synchronization information. The descrambling process is accomplished by precisely reversing the scrambling operation, making the system self-synchronizing.
The one-bit-out-of-N-bit checking circuit patent involves a series of detector levels that accommodate multiple input signal lines. Each detector level is designed to detect excitation signals and generate error signals accordingly. The k-th detector level produces an output signal in response to the presence of an excitation signal on only one of the input signal lines, enhancing the reliability of data transmission.
